GM 4.2 liter V-6 Deactivation
I want to deactivate one bank of three cylinders to see if, or how much, it will improve my mileage. Pulling three spark plug leads proved the engine will start and run smoothly, giving me about as much performance as my old '46 Chevrolet did. I'd be happy with that.
I plan to back off the lifters on one bank so the pistons are just bouncing on air. Obviously some friction loss there. I plan to disconnect the fuel injectors on the one bank. I am concerned that the Oxygen sensor on the deactivated bank will remain cold, and therefore tell the computer to keep the mixture rich. I need some advice there. That would also result in not being able to pass a smog test. I can't imagine no one has ever tried this before, so there must be some good advice out there. |
